Kambo is scientifically known as Phyllomedusa bicolor is a species of tree frogs found in the Amazon rainforest. The frog’s secretion is utilized in Kambo ceremonies due to its potential therapeutic properties. Kambo was used traditionally by indigenous tribes to attain diverse objectives, such as detoxification, energy restoration as well as spiritual connections.
